This document outlines a $326 million bond referendum proposed for White Bear Lake Area Schools to address a projected student population growth of approximately 2,000 students over the next decade. The comprehensive plan focuses on investing in facilities for improved safety and security, consolidating the split-campus high school into a single building, and designing flexible classrooms to support student-centered instruction. It also includes enhancements for community education programs and the Senior Center. The plan, developed with community input, aims to transform the school district for future decades, elevate career pathway programs, and provide an opportunity to redesign the high school experience.
The work session included an update on Vadnais Heights Elementary, covering enrollment demographics, academic achievement goals, and school-wide highlights. The board also reviewed an update on the 2019 Building Our Future Bond Referendum and facilities projects, including a financial summary of completed and ongoing projects. Furthermore, the board acted to award a bid for parking lot additions at Sunrise Park and White Bear Lake Area High School to Northwest Asphalt, Inc. The session also included a discussion on labor negotiations.
The School Board reviewed updates on the Early Childhood and Early Childhood Special Education program and discussed a proposed transition from an Area Learning Center to an Alternative Learning Program to enhance academic flexibility. Additionally, the board received a mid-year report on academic progress and discussed the 2026-2029 Achievement and Integration Plan. Action was taken to authorize the purchase of three electric school buses, and the board formally approved the structural transition and implementation plan for the alternative learning pathways.
The meeting provided a comprehensive update on the 2019 Bond Referendum and associated facilities projects. Discussion topics included an overview of the facility planning process, the master plan financing and phasing strategy, and a detailed review of project scopes, schedules, and budgets for various schools and district facilities. The board also reviewed the planning principles for the Future of Learning initiative and received project photography and budget summaries for completed and ongoing construction projects across the district.
The work session included an update on Vadnais Heights Elementary School and a comprehensive review of construction progress and budget status for projects funded by the 2019 referendum. The board formally accepted a bid for parking lot additions at Sunrise Park and White Bear Lake Area High School in the amount of $1,524,000. Additionally, the session included a closed portion dedicated to reviewing strategy and information regarding labor negotiations.
